1 /*
2  * lzodefs.h -- architecture, OS and compiler specific defines
3  *
4  * Copyright (C) 1996-2005 Markus F.X.J. Oberhumer <[email protected]>
5  *
6  * The full LZO package can be found at:
7  * http://www.oberhumer.com/opensource/lzo/
8  *
9  * Changed for kernel use by:
10  * Nitin Gupta <[email protected]>
11  * Richard Purdie <[email protected]>
12  */
13 
14 #define LZO_VERSION 0x2020
15 #define LZO_VERSION_STRING "2.02"
16 #define LZO_VERSION_DATE "Oct 17 2005"
17 
18 #define M1_MAX_OFFSET 0x0400
19 #define M2_MAX_OFFSET 0x0800
20 #define M3_MAX_OFFSET 0x4000
21 #define M4_MAX_OFFSET 0xbfff
22 
23 #define M1_MIN_LEN 2
24 #define M1_MAX_LEN 2
25 #define M2_MIN_LEN 3
26 #define M2_MAX_LEN 8
27 #define M3_MIN_LEN 3
28 #define M3_MAX_LEN 33
29 #define M4_MIN_LEN 3
30 #define M4_MAX_LEN 9
31 
32 #define M1_MARKER 0
33 #define M2_MARKER 64
34 #define M3_MARKER 32
35 #define M4_MARKER 16
36 
37 #define D_BITS 14
38 #define D_MASK ((1u << D_BITS) - 1)
39 #define D_HIGH ((D_MASK >> 1) + 1)
40 
41 #define DX2(p, s1, s2) (((((size_t)((p)[2]) << (s2)) ^ (p)[1]) \
42  << (s1)) ^ (p)[0])
43 #define DX3(p, s1, s2, s3) ((DX2((p)+1, s2, s3) << (s1)) ^ (p)[0])
